OpenGPI Release 0.4: An Open and Generic Parameter Interface

Description

OpenGPI (Open Generic Parameter Interface) is an open-source software aiming at providing a configuration interface in a very generic way. The required configuration options of another software are described by metadata (XML) through which OpenGPI automatically sets up a graphical user interface (GUI). It allows defining dependencies between different options to assist users. After setting up the parameters within OpenGPI, these can be written into XML files to configure the users' software and to run their executables or visualize image outputs.

Release comments:
Now, your simulation files can be shown at the runpage, similar to a gif. A Make-Button has been added to compile your executable comfortably. After your executable has been finished, you can continue with loading your simulation files. Start- and Stop-Buttons are included so you are able to have control over your simulation process. Different simulation options are available.
